math.FA2005

A description of (Cp​[Lp​(M)],Rp​[Lp​(M)])θ​

Quanhua Xu

We give a simple explicit description of the norm in the complex interpolation space (Cp​[Lp​(M)],Rp​[Lp​(M)])θ​ for any von Neumann algebra M and any 1≤p≤∞.
